Community Comes Together for Sunday’s Free Health Fair: Families and Young Adults Embrace Wellness!

Free‍ Healthcare Services Offered to Lubbock Families

LUBBOCK, Texas (KCBD) – ⁣On Sunday, ⁣residents of Lubbock, including⁤ families and young adults, were afforded the chance to access a variety of health/governor-signs-groundbreaking-laws-for-homeschooling-healthcare-and-mental-health-in-alaska/” title=”Governor signs groundbreaking laws for homeschooling, healthcare, and mental health in Alaska”>healthcare‍ services at no ​cost.

Community Efforts for Health Awareness

A coalition of local organizations‍ and dedicated volunteers came together to offer an array of health assessments. ​Attendees could‌ receive checks for blood pressure ‌and glucose levels, EKG screenings, ‌as well as evaluations for conditions such as​ depression, anxiety, and sleep apnea.

Educational Resources from Local Nonprofits

The ‌event also featured several⁢ booths run by nearby nonprofits⁣ that provided free educational ⁣materials and resources aimed at promoting ⁢health awareness among participants.

A Focus on ‍Young Adults​ and ‌Families

While the health fair welcomed all community ⁣members, Dr. Niiang Mung, the event’s⁣ organizer, expressed her specific intent to reach out ​to young adults and families. According to her findings, this demographic often requires regular health updates⁢ more urgently than others.

Family-Friendly Activities ​Enhance the ⁢Experience

The day was not just about⁤ health; it also included ⁣fun⁤ activities for children. Young attendees enjoyed a ⁤bounce house, bubbles ⁤galore, exciting prizes, and lively music—creating an engaging environment that emphasized both wellness and enjoyment.
